The mission of the Center Helping Obesity In Children End Successfully, Inc. (C.H.O.I.C.E.S.) is to be a parent and child resource center for the clinically diagnosed and at risk children of obesity. Over the last 19 years, C.H.O.I.C.E.S. has delivered its message of health to more than 125,000 children and adults through cooking classes, workshops, summer camps and health expos.
With programs like Cooking with C.H.O.I.C.E.S., Camp Divas, Let's Move! Dekalb and now our new Community Teaching Kitchen, we are tackling childhood obesity and helping families in the Atlanta community lead healthier lives.
